King Frederik IX
Denmark · 1970 · 10 øre
This definitive stamp features a right-facing portrait of King Frederik IX of Denmark. The design is a classic engraved portrait, common for definitive series of the era, emphasizing the monarch's authority and presence. The denomination '10' is in the upper left, with 'DANMARK' below the portrait.
Issued in 1970, this stamp was part of a long-running definitive series during the reign of King Frederik IX, who ruled from 1947 until his death in 1972. This series was in use during a period of post-war prosperity and social change in Denmark.
Printing Method
Engraved
